Which earth material is most used by humans?

Most of that stuff is concrete—humanity’s favorite building material—followed by gravel, bricks, asphalt, and metals. If current trends continue, these manufactured materials will weigh more than twice as much as all life on Earth by 2040, or about 2.2 trillion tons.

Q. What are things that humans use that are provided by the Earth?

Natural resources are materials from the Earth that are used to support life and meet people’s needs. Any natural substance that humans use can be considered a natural resource. Oil, coal, natural gas, metals, stone and sand are natural resources. Other natural resources are air, sunlight, soil and water.

Q. How are materials harmful to people?

Very toxic materials are substances that may cause significant harm or even death to an individual if even very small amounts enter the body. These materials may enter the body in different ways (called the route of exposure). The most common route of exposure is through inhalation (breathing it into the lungs).

Q. Are the waste materials harmful to your health?

Metals. Heavy metals are known to pose a considerable health risk in the waste management sector. More than 30 different metals have been detected in the incinerated ash of unsorted urban waste, and most of these metals, such as arsenic, cadmium, chromium, lead, and mercury, are harmful to human health.

Q. What is an acid rain Class 8?

Answer: Pollutants like sulphur dioxide and nitrogen dioxide liberated into the air by industries reacts with water vapour in air to form sulphuric acid and nitric acid. These acids come down as rain, called acid rain.

Q. What are the different ways in which water gets polluted?

Water pollution can be caused in a number of ways, one of the most polluting being city sewage and industrial waste discharge. Indirect sources of water pollution include contaminants that enter the water supply from soils or groundwater systems and from the atmosphere via rain.
